theScore esports features and specs

  • Comprehensive Coverage
    theScore esports offers extensive coverage across various esports titles, providing news, updates, and analysis for a diverse range of games including League of Legends, CS:GO, Dota 2, and others.
  • High-Quality Content
    Their articles, videos, and podcasts are produced with a high standard of quality, often featuring in-depth analysis and insights from industry experts.
  • Mobile App Accessibility
    theScore esports provides a mobile app that allows users to access news and updates on the go, making it convenient for users to stay informed.
  • Regular Updates
    Frequent updates ensure that the content is current, providing users with timely information about esports events and news.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The website and app have a clean and intuitive interface, making it easy for users to navigate and find the content they are interested in.

Possible disadvantages of theScore esports

  • Limited Coverage of Smaller Titles
    While theScore esports covers major esports titles extensively, smaller or emerging games may receive less attention and less comprehensive coverage.
  • Ad-Driven Model
    The website and app may contain ads, which can be distracting for some users and detract from the overall user experience.
  • Content Volume
    With the sheer amount of content available, it can sometimes be overwhelming for users to filter through the information to find what they are looking for.
  • Video Content Over Text
    Some users may prefer written content over videos, and the emphasis on video content might not cater to their preferences.
  • Regional Bias
    As with many esports coverage sites, there might be a bias towards certain regions, leading to more coverage for North American or European esports events compared to others.

JavaScript features and specs

  • Wide Browser Support
    JavaScript is supported by all modern web browsers without the need for any plugins, making it highly versatile for client-side scripting.
  • Asynchronous Programming
    JavaScript supports asynchronous programming with features like callbacks, Promises, and async/await, which helps in efficiently handling tasks such as HTTP requests.
  • Rich Ecosystem and Libraries
    The JavaScript ecosystem includes a vast amount of libraries and frameworks like React, Angular, Vue, and Node.js, which streamline development processes.
  • Community Support
    JavaScript has a large and active community, providing extensive resources, documentation, and forums for troubleshooting and development advice.
  • Event-Driven
    The language is inherently event-driven, making it suitable for developing interactive web applications that react to user inputs.
  • Full-Stack Development
    With the advent of Node.js, JavaScript can be used for both client-side and server-side development, enabling full-stack development using a single language.

Possible disadvantages of JavaScript

  • Security Issues
    Being an interpreted language that runs in the browser, JavaScript code is visible to the user, making it susceptible to security risks such as Cross-Site Scripting (XSS).
  • Browser Compatibility
    While JavaScript itself is widely supported, different browsers may implement JavaScript functions and standards differently, leading to compatibility issues.
  • Performance
    JavaScript is generally slower than compiled languages such as C++ or Java. Heavy computations can lead to performance bottlenecks.
  • Single Inheritance
    JavaScript uses prototypal inheritance instead of classical inheritance, which can be confusing for developers coming from object-oriented programming backgrounds.
  • Dynamic Typing
    JavaScript's dynamic typing can lead to runtime errors that are hard to debug, as variable types are checked at runtime rather than during compilation.
  • Fragmentation
    The ecosystem has many competing libraries, frameworks, and tools, which can make it overwhelming for developers to choose the right technologies for their projects.
